TouchDesigner Workshop

We’ll walk through the core building blocks called Operators, where we will focus on the ones used to handle images and video (aka TOPs). After the introduction, there is time to experiment and begin your own small project. You’re welcome to bring images or video to play with, but it’s not required. Prior coding experience can be helpful, but it’s not required — just bring your own laptop with TouchDesigner installed (free for non-commercial use).

Ikebana Rest-shop

Ikebana (生け花) flower arrangement rest-shop is a gentle, hands-on experience in Japanese flower arranging, guided by mindfulness and intentionality. You’ll take home your own Ikebana flower arrangement, along with a flower frog (kenzan).
